Panama Golden Frog
Extinct In The Wild
Zoo Article

The Panama Golden Frog once thrived in the rain and cloud forests of Panama, but numbers have plummeted since the appearance of the fungal disease chytridiomycosis, also known as chytrid fungus. While they are believed to be extinct in the wild, populations are healthy and steady in captivity.

The Panama Golden Frog is a distant cousin of the poison dart frog, and its neuro toxin has been named "zetekitoxin" after its scientific name. Zetekitoxin is the most dangerous toxin out of all other toxins produced by the other frogs in the Golden Frog's family, Bufonidae.

Something interesting about the Golden Frog is that while males can produce a loud whistle, the frogs also exhibit a form of "sign-language," waving their arms and legs to communicate. These waves can be used to protect territory, attract a mate, and greet other frogs.

Golden Frogs can appear light yellow/green to their trademark yellow. They may also have black spots, though some individuals have no spots at all.

Zoos are currently working on building a breeding habitat in Panama for the frogs, in hopes of reintroducing them to their native habitat.
